<h3>What is plenum rated cable mean?</h3>
Plenum rated cable is known to be a kind of a cable that tends to have a unique form of insulation that is known to have low smoke and low flame attribute.

The general syntax of array declaration in assembly is given by
Array_Name TYPE value1, value2,...
where type can be BYTE, WORD, DWORD, QWORD, REAL4 etc
where values can be in decimal, binary, or hexadecimal
Example:
Let us define an array of type unsigned byte and named myArray containing decimal values of 10, 20, and 30.
myArray BYTE 10, 20, 30
